Early Game

The official line says this match lasted 0:10, with both sides locked at 2.5k gold, 0 kills, 0 towers, 0 dragons, and 0 barons. That is not a conventional competitive arc; it is a severely abbreviated or incomplete record attached to a confirmed Gen.G victory.

Still, the player sheet offers clues about the intended battlefield. Jiwoo’s Kalista showed 5/2/4 and a +468 GoldDiff@15, while Cuzz added 6/2/7 on Pantheon with +281. Those figures point toward KT Rolster pressure in the lanes and jungle, precisely the early snowball route forecast before draft.

The Turning Point

The first surprise was not an upset but the draft’s departure from prediction. Orianna, flagged before the match with 78.2% presence and a 61.8% ban rate, was not removed; Bdd received her. His 4/5/8 line confirms the champion appeared as predicted, but it cannot prove she delivered the expected control because the team-level ledger records no completed action.

Gen.G’s answer was a more protective composition. Duro’s Lulu reached 2/2/10, and that pick mattered strategically against Renata Glasc: it reinforced the scaling identity the pre-draft analysis favored. The available numbers show KT’s early gold edges, but not the decisive sequence that turned the game.

Closing Out

What is certain is the result: Gen.G Esports won Game 1 and now lead KT Rolster 1-0. Chovy’s Ryze recorded 4/3/6 with a +76 GoldDiff@15, a small mid-lane edge that fits Gen.G’s preference for dependable scaling rather than a volatile race.

The absence of objective gains means there is no legitimate tower, dragon, baron, or kill-score finish to celebrate. For LCK 2026 context, the victory sets the tone, but the 0:10 entry demands caution: Gen.G earned the series lead, while the official dataset does not support a conventional claim of domination.
